Chapter 171 Two choices given to Li Yunlong by the headquarters

The two of them walked out of Yushe Middle School while chatting. The brigade commander took the riding whip handed over by the guard and got on his horse, with a look of reminiscence on his face.

“That kid has changed a lot since he went to the logistics department to raise pigs for a few months. He is no longer the **** he was before.”

"Last time I went to inspect the New Second Regiment, I actually saw a lot of books on his desk. You don't even know my expression at that time. It was more surprising and surprising than picking up a few howitzers."

The thin staff member nodded in agreement. In the past, Li Yunlong would show off his skills every once in a while, sometimes bringing surprises to others, and sometimes causing trouble. The balance of merit and demerit often happened to him.

But since joining the New Second Regiment, he has honestly completed all the tasks assigned by his superiors, and even asked him to plow the railway without any complaints.

“Yes, this kid is no longer the thorn in the side who buys and sells by force when crossing the grass. Lao Xu must be more happy than the two of us now, haha.”

“Okay, let's tell him about this in advance. After all, it is an experimental force that we have never had contact with. Give him a little more time to prepare in advance.”

After finishing speaking, the thin staff member touched the neck of the war horse in front of him, and the two of them set off towards the station of the New Second Regiment. Seemingly thinking of something interesting, he continued with a smile:

"You are so confident. Maybe Li Yunlong will choose the former. Then I will want to see if you are embarrassed."

 In fact, the deputy commander-in-chief gave the New Second Regiment two options. Although they were both promotions, they were two completely different routes.

 The first option is to receive further training and then send him to open up a new military sector.

Since the Logistics Department gained the ability to mass-produce weapons and ammunition, the entire army has been developing rapidly, and all base areas have shown a tendency to expand.

 After all, the Eighth Route Army also faces the same problem as the Jinsui Army, that is, the current land cannot support more people.

Food problems have always troubled the headquarters. After all, whether it is the expansion of the army or the expansion of base areas, it will cause a series of burdens on the people.

For example, in the original work, Li Yunlong completed a wave of crazy military expansion during the Pingler period, which was very unreasonable.

Let's not discuss the disasters and plagues in North China during that period, and whether Zhaojiayu had so many manpower to absorb. Let's just calculate the cost of expanding the army to 7,000 men.

 The addition of 5,000 men to the army means that the local labor force has been reduced by more than 5,000 young and middle-aged people, and more than 5,000 manual workers have been added to the region. This food consumption is doubled.

 Let's not talk about Li Yunlong's private expansion of the army. How will the brigade commander react? Just when Zhang Wanhe saw that a certain unit had five thousand more mouths, he would have to come out from the logistics department to kill that commander.

 In the era of small-scale peasant economy, people are the main labor force.

 Expansion that ignores the local labor force will directly drain the local labor resources and cause a shortage of agricultural labor. In the end, it will definitely lead to the economic collapse of the region.

 Why did the headquarters only require the 120th Division to dispatch 4 to 6 main regiments when allocating the first phase of troops?

This is not because the deputy commander-in-chief looks down on Commander Huzi. He is a unit that joined with soldiers and supplies in the most difficult days.

 It's not because the terrain in northwestern Shanxi is complex, and it is not a densely populated area or a major agricultural area.

 The development of the 120th Division there is relatively slow, and the ability to dispatch 4 to 6 main regiments is already the limit.

Even though there were 105 regiments participating in the first phase of the Hundred Regiment War, some of them were semi- or non-professional militiamen, and they accounted for a large proportion in the battle sequence of the raid.

  Opening a new military division is a difficult task. It requires not only a commander with high awareness and the ability to lead troops to fight, but also a capable political commissar.

 Coordinated production accounts for a large proportion of political work, which is to keep frontline soldiers fed and clothed.

Zhao Gang did a very good job in this regard. He not only led the masses to do farm work, but also often summoned local enlightened gentry to talk about unity in the war of resistance.

His existence is very important to the people in the base area. It is a benchmark for implementing rent and interest reductions and a beacon for resolving all problems.

With the addition of two men, one civil and one military, the New Second Regiment has the foundation to independently open up a new military region. They can even support nearby friendly forces while revitalizing a military area.

 The deputy commander took these factors into consideration before giving the first option. I hope that in the future, both Li Yunlong and Zhao Gang can become independent senior talents in the army.

The second one is to make the New Second Regiment a special force. This idea was proposed by Huang He, who took into account that Li and Zhao were more interested in fighting.

Although it is still a regiment-level unit, its status is definitely higher than that of the main regiment, and it will definitely become a pioneer in this field in the future.

Facing the ridicule of his old partner, the thin staff officer, the brigade commander looked like he had a chance to win.

“We have all seen Li Yunlong's experience over the years, and he has made a lot of contributions.”

“This year alone, I killed Nobutsu Sakata and captured a regiment flag. Together with Zheng Yingqi, I rescued a doctor and captured a cavalry battalion. I supported the 772nd Regiment and the 385th Brigade, and also killed a major general.”

“When I count down the number of things, I'm a little surprised. I've done so many great things without knowing it.”

“He was born for the battlefield and is an excellent soldier. Opening up a new military region is more suitable for Cheng Shifa, and Li Yunlong would not choose it.”

The brigade commander said this and did not continue, but anyone could see the satisfaction on his face.

Staff officer Shouzi took over the conversation and added: "Why did you forget about the surprise attack on Taiyuan Airport?"

“Our troops have no air defense at all, and there is no way to fight back against the Japanese planes. What the soldiers fear most is air strikes. When the news was announced this morning, the morale improved visibly.”

“Huang He, Zhang Wanhe, and Li Yunlong, it's really not too much to praise the three heroes of the Dabie Mountains.”

 After mentioning the Yellow River, the brigade commander's expression became a little solemn, and he remembered the intelligence he had recently received.

 When new weapons appeared in the army before, they did not attract the attention of the outside world because they had not yet been fully deployed.

But since the end of the first phase of the Hundred Regiment War, the Japanese have discovered that the Eighth Route Army's grassroots firepower is ridiculously strong, and it is obvious that they have gotten rid of Japanese weapons and reloaded bullets.

Such a huge number made Xiaori realize that the other party must have its own arsenal, so the North China Front Army sent a large number of spies and used the intelligence network.

 In recent times, agents from Xiaozhi have been digging into the base like crazy. Even some people who were not that concerned about the Asian battlefield cast curious glances.

"After our Hundred Regiment War is over, we must send that boy from Huang He to the rear areas no matter what! The deputy director has already made harsh words, and he must be kidnapped!"

“Southern Shanxi is no longer safe now. After we reveal our strength, the little devils will definitely find a way to deal with us.”

“Even the Logistics Department must move before the Japs' North China Front recovers, otherwise they will definitely be bombed.”

Outside Yushe County, the temporary residence of the New Second Regiment.

Most of the soldiers were carrying weapons. The Japanese were too generous this time and left a lot of supplies behind. Even with the help of local people, the comrades would have to transport it for at least half a day.

Li Yunlong, who had been running around all night, had just returned. At this time, he took Le Zhengdou and Wang Chengzhu to the field command post to tell the story of the shelling of Taiyuan Airport.

"Hahaha, you don't know how exciting this battle is. Seven 82mm mortars and a thousand rounds of artillery shells! We, Lao Li, have never fought such a rich battle."

“You can see the thick smoke coming out of Taiyuan Airport from several miles away. The Japanese's ground crew is not good either. It seems they are the same as their navy's damage control team.”

 The proud Captain Li saw Zhao Gang coming in and said with a smile:

“Old Zhao, our New Second Regiment has made great achievements again this time! We haven't seen the Japanese plane all day! Taiyuan Airport must be completely paralyzed.”

Suddenly, Zhao Gang, who was still jovial at first, became serious. He saw the blood on the other person's body, so he showed a concerned and angry expression like an old mother.

“Li Yunlong, did you lead the commando up again? How many times have I told you, as a regiment leader, can you please stop taking Zhang Dabiao's job!”

This scene immediately made Commander Li's face drop. In order to break the spell cast by his political commissar, he quickly called the three guards outside to testify against him.

“Political Commissar, our regiment leader was honest this time and really didn't go with the commando. The blood belongs to the Japanese cavalry. I am a monk and I will not tell lies.”

 Zhao Gang, who was in a better mood, suddenly saw the blood on Wei Dayong's forehead. He gently took off the opponent's military cap, then pointed at his wound and said helplessly:

"Okay, I finally understand. It's the three of you who will rush forward this time, isn't it? It's the guard's fault. I'm really speechless."

 “Are you afraid that your captain will be injured, why don't you rush in and kill all the Japs?”

“Damn it, go find a hygienist and take care of it. I'm not afraid of infection and inflammation if you cover the wound in this summer.”

Just as everyone was happily summing up the battle, Captain Li suddenly felt a kind of suppression coming from his bloodline, and even the hairs on the back of his neck stood up.

 “Li Yunlong!”

This voice was so thunderous and powerful that Lao Li was so frightened that his whole body trembled. Before he could see who was coming, he immediately ran out of the temporary command post.

When he went out, he had a flattering smile on his face and took out a pack of seized cigarettes.

“Hey! Brigadier! What kind of wind has brought you here! Come in quickly! Da Biao! Go outside and bring two boxes in! The brigade commander and staff are here to express their condolences to us!”

Looking at Li Yunlong's shameless face, the brigade commander helplessly covered his forehead. At this moment, he felt that Li Yunlong had made no progress.

 He took the cigarette and handed it to the thin staff officer, and said hello to everyone.

“In order to live a few more years, I have given up smoking. You guys should also smoke less, it is not good for your health.”

 After Zhang Dabiao came back, everyone sat down.

As soon as the brigade commander threw the riding crop on the table, Li Yunlong stood up with a loud noise and reported: "Report to the brigade commander! Our new second regiment can successfully complete the mission this time because of your patient teachings!"

This unusual behavior made everyone a little puzzled. Even the thin staff member couldn't figure out what the other party was singing.

“Are you okay, kid? Why are you so excited today? You feel guilty after having made a great contribution? Could it be that you want to swallow my batch of 82mm mortars without conscience?”

 After hearing these words, Li Yunlong looked upright, as if he had become a different person.

"Look at what you said, this is not to kill people. Those things are public property, and they must be returned after use. It's just that the bombardment of the airport was a bit harsh, and two of the cannons were broken."

Originally I thought the brigade commander would scold him, but the other party waved his hand indifferently.

 In a while, the Logistics Department will be able to produce various types of French artillery.

The 82 mm mortar, although valuable, must be eliminated sooner or later. What's more, it was damaged during the mission, and he is not an unreasonable person.

“You have done well this year, with many meritorious deeds and no trouble. This time, you proposed and executed the bombardment of the airport, leaving the Japanese First Army with no aircraft to use. This is another great achievement.”

“Our Eighth Route Army has always made clear rewards and punishments, and the headquarters has decided to give you a promotion. As my subordinate, I have secured two options for you.”

"The first item is that after the Hundred Regiment War, you hand over the affairs of the regiment to Zhao Gang, and then follow me back to the brigade headquarters to study for half a year. After the study, you lead the new second regiment to open a new military region near our Taiyue Military Region. "

“Perhaps in a few years, I will call you Brigadier Li Da.”

 After hearing these words, Li Yunlong almost cried. Although he has a good relationship with the brigade commander and respects each other very much.

But letting him take charge of a military region is a bit torturous. It's not because he doesn't want to learn or take responsibility, it's just that he simply doesn't want to leave the battlefield.

 In his opinion, the brigade commander can go to the battlefield several times a year, and the subordinate regiment-level units must be responsible for anything.

Captain Li Da even thought that after he became the brigade commander, he would watch Zhang Dabiao fighting every day, and he would have to wipe his behind behind him.

 At this moment, Lao Li suddenly understood how tired the brigade commander had been over the years. So before the other party finished speaking the first item, he immediately answered:

“The second option! The second option! I choose the second option!”

Seeing how Li Yunlong was afraid of going to the brigade headquarters to study, the thin staff officer laughed out loud. The laughter was so contagious that everyone in the command room except Li Yunlong and the brigade commander couldn't help it.

“Are you so scared of me? I won't eat you! When you don't make mistakes, there's no time when I'm not smiling!”

The brigade commander became more and more angry as he talked. He picked up the whip and whipped Li Yunlong lightly a few times. Then he adjusted his mood and asked with some gloating:

 “Li Yunlong, are you afraid of heights?”
